The Braemar BMQ 315 Gas Ducted Heater PCB Circuit Board ICS Stage 1 (with part numbers PN. 651422/651965) is a critical component in the Braemar BMQ 315 gas ducted heating system. Here’s a detailed breakdown of what this part does and its features:
1. Function of the PCB (Printed Circuit Board):
- The PCB circuit board acts as the central control unit of the Braemar BMQ 315 Gas Ducted Heater. It serves as the brain of the heating system, managing and coordinating the operation of various components.
- It controls the sequence of operations, such as when to ignite the gas burner, operate the fan, monitor temperatures, and ensure that the heater functions in a safe and efficient manner.

4. Key Features:
- Control of Heater Functions: The PCB controls key functions such as fan operation, gas ignition, temperature regulation, and safety shutdowns.
- Safety Features: It includes safety checks to monitor the system for any faults such as overheating, gas leaks, or flame failure. If any issues are detected, it can trigger an automatic shutdown or lockout to prevent damage or unsafe conditions.
- Fan & Burner Coordination: The circuit board coordinates the operation of the fan motor and gas burner, ensuring they work in harmony to provide consistent and efficient heating.
5. Common Issues:
- Failure to Ignite: If the PCB fails, it might not send the signal to the ignition system to start the gas burner, which can prevent the heater from turning on.
- Erratic Heater Operation: A faulty PCB might cause the heater to behave erratically, such as turning off unexpectedly, not reaching the desired temperature, or having intermittent fan operation.
- Error Codes or Lockout: In some cases, a malfunctioning PCB may trigger error codes or put the system into a safety lockout mode if it detects irregularities like sensor issues, overheating, or electrical faults.
6. Replacement:
- If you're experiencing issues like ignition failure, inconsistent heating, or error codes, the PCB circuit board might need to be replaced. Be sure to use the exact part numbers 651422 or 651965 to ensure the new board is compatible with your heater model.
- Installation: Replacing the PCB involves turning off the power and gas supply to the unit, removing the old board, and installing the new one. It's important to reconnect all wiring according to the manufacturer's instructions to ensure proper operation.
- Calibration: After replacing the PCB, the system may need to be calibrated to ensure proper communication between the control board and the rest of the components (e.g., fan, burner, thermostat).
7. Maintenance:
- Cleaning and Inspection: Regularly inspect the PCB for dust, dirt, or signs of damage. Dust buildup on the board can cause overheating or short-circuiting. A gentle cleaning with compressed air can help keep the board in good condition.
- Professional Service: Since working with gas and electrical components can be hazardous, it's recommended to have a licensed technician replace or service the PCB if you're not comfortable doing it yourself.
